Austin Reaves makes this team go, leading the club in points per game, rebounds per game and assists per game. He has scored 16 points or more in three straight games, four or more assists in five straight games and six or more rebounds in three straight road games.

Overall, this is a very efficient team. They rank 91st in points per game while also ranking 89th in points allowed per game. Three main statistics stand out for Oklahoma's strengths - free throws, rebounding and steals.

Oklahoma hits 74.1% of its free throws (ranks 68th nationally), average 37.4 rebounds per game (ranks 94th nationally) and averages 7.6 steals per game (ranks 69th). De'Vion Harmon, who averages 12.5 points per game, averages 1.2 steals per game but that's just the third-most on the team.

Elijah Harkless and Umoja Gibson average over 1.4 steals per game, while Gibson is also the best three-point shooter on the team. That might come in handy if Oklahoma can't bang down low with West Virginia's big man (will get to in a minute).

The paint will be crucial in this game for Oklahoma, as their free throw shooting and rebounding is in jeopardy entering the game. The Mountaineers have a beast of a big man down low, so both will be hard to come by. This game is on the shoulders' of Austin Reaves, as he leads the team in rebounding, free throw percentage and free throw attempts per game.

Derek Culver is the name to watch in this game. He averages a double-double, and will bear the burden of making sure Oklahoma doesn't play through their strengths on the glass and on the line.

Culver has scored 15 points or more in three of his last four games, while also seeing a double-double in two of his last four games. He has seen at least eight rebounds in five straight games, while also seeing 12 or more rebounds in four of his last eight.

If Culver produces like this, it will continue to open up the other Mountaineers to produce on offense. The most notable is Miles McBride, but Taz Sherman and Sean McNeil are also playing very well. West Virginia is on a three-game winning streak, overly impressive in their last two against Texas Tech and Kansas.

Yes, Culver and McBride are the catalysts of those results but McNeil saw 26 against Texas Tech and Sherman saw 25 against Kansas. The role player are beginning to step up, as the Mountaineers are one of the most dangerous teams currently.

However, West Virginia is known for inconsistent play. Those concerns are usually on the road, but the location seems not to matter much when Culver and McBride are playing their roles while the role players are beginning to play with scary conviction.
